What “compensation” means
- noun
something (such as money) given or received as payment or reparation (as for a service or loss or injury)
- noun
(psychiatry) a defense mechanism that conceals your undesirable shortcomings by exaggerating desirable behaviors
- noun
the act of compensating for service or loss or injury

How do you pronounce “compensation”?
“compensation” is pronounced /ˌkɑmpənˈseɪʃən/ (kahm-puhn-SAY-shuhn) in American English and /kɒmpənseɪʃən/ in British English — 4 syllables, stressed on “sat”. Build it as com-pen-SAT-ion, then run the third syllable a little longer than the rest and let the others reduce.
How many syllables does “compensation” have?
4: com · pen · sat · ion. The beat lands on the third, “sat”.
Is “compensation” said differently in British English?
Yes. American English says /ˌkɑmpənˈseɪʃən/ (kahm-puhn-SAY-shuhn); British English says /kɒmpənseɪʃən/. Both are correct — choose the accent you are learning and stay inside it.
